Where are the mint marks on a Morgan silver dollar?
On Morgan dollars, the mint mark is found underneath the wreath surrounding the eagle. Mint marks on Peace dollars appear on the lower left of the coin, just left of the eagle’s tail feathers. Coins minted in Philadelphia have no mint mark. The pictures below show where to find mint marks on both silver dollars.
Where is the mint mark on an 1888 silver dollar?
The US minted the 1888 silver dollar with no mint mark and also the 1888 O silver dollar and 1888 S silver dollar. The mint mark, when present, can be found on the reverse side of the coin below the wreath.
